NATIONAL: Employees across Ebix Group’s offices in India have come together with Saahas NGO to support communities affected by the recent floods in Assam through a nationwide donation drive.
The employee-led initiative brought together colleagues from across locations to collect essential relief supplies, including dry rations, hygiene kits, blankets, clothing and other daily-use items. The collected material was handed over for distribution to flood-affected families through Saahas NGO.
Nearly 4,000 Ebix employees participated in the initiative, contributing voluntarily to the relief effort. Given the immediate needs of affected communities and the time required to transport relief material, employees were encouraged to donate non-perishable items that could be safely stored and distributed.
The collective effort resulted in the collection of more than 350 boxes of relief material. Each contribution represented the willingness of employees across Ebix Group to come together and extend support to families facing difficult circumstances.
